Unleash the power of multi-core processing with the AMD Threadripper 2920X. Designed for demanding workloads and high-performance computing, this processor delivers exceptional speed and responsiveness for content creation, gaming, and more.

  • 12 Cores and 24 Threads for exceptional multitasking
  • Base Clock of 3.5GHz with a Boost Clock up to 4.3GHz
  • Unlocked Clock Multiplier for Overclocking
  • Quad-Channel DDR4-2933 Memory Support
  • Large 38MB Cache (1152K L1, 6MB L2, 32MB L3)
  • 180W TDP
Cores / Threads 12 / 24
Base Clock 3.5 GHz
Boost Clock 4.3 GHz
L1 Cache 1152K
L2 Cache 6MB
L3 Cache 32MB
Memory Support Quad Channel DDR4-2933
TDP 180W
Socket TR4
